I will be purchasing my grandmother's 2001 chevy malibu with only 20K miles on it.  As the vehicle has sat in a garage for several winters in a row, and many of the miles on the car are tow miles from RV trips, are there things that I need to be aware from non-use of the vehicle?  I don't want to get raked by the dealership in town when I bring it in for service, but I also don't want to get stranded on a trip.  Thanks.

are you wanting to do it yourself or what to tell the repair shop.I would recommend a 50,000 mile service/all fluids and filters belts and hoses/thermostat lube your chassie and most likely tires need replacing your emisson controls should be ok put in a can of good fuel system cleaner before you drive too much
